MIX07: Wow!
Some events are just better than others. This one was top-notch and I can unequivocally say I thought it was better than last year. And I loved last year.
It started right. I think everyone was blown away by the CLR integration in Silverlight and the fantastic first-day keynote where that was announced set a tone for the rest of the (half) week. The energy was amazing. I came home exhausted and not because I had been living la vida vegas. I couldn’t help but give whatever discretionary time I had to Silverlight. I had to. The excitement was contagious and it wore me out.
My favorite moment in the keynote–maybe at the event–was when Scott Guthrie showed C# bulldozing JavaScript through a game of chess. You can actually see this yourself here. That was the moment when I knew something important had happened. CLR in the browser actually meant what it said–the power of a compiled, sophisticated language like C# actually running right in the browser. I was blown away.
Other favorite moments were:
1. A great conversation I had with Lee Brimelow about animation in which he introduced me to Robert Penner’s killer easing equations for Flash.
2. The session I did with Nathan about the Comic Reader we created for WPF. This project was so much fun. We put it together in about 10 days. It was a pretty intense effort, but it flew by because were were having so much fun! The session turned out great and I got to imagine what I might look like as a super hero.
3. The IdentiyMine dinner at Zeffirino. When I called my wife that night to tell her about the dinner, the only way I could think to describe it was to say it felt like eating at the cool kids table. Thanks to everyone who joined us. It was a blast.
4. This one isn’t so much a moment as a feeling. When I was at Microsoft I used to go to a lot of Flash conferences and when I did, I could sense the comradery of that community. You could tell that the it was a really positive thing. As Microsoft guy, though, I wasn’t really setup to be a part of it. MIX this year had that vibe, though. It was awesome! WPF seemed all grown up. The conversations were about what were doing with WPF, not what we could or wanted to do. And with real projects came real challenges and, overall, the conversations were interesting, hands on and real. It was great.
5. Okay, one last Silverlight plug. The final great moment I read came Wednesday morning when I started to catch up on the buzz outside of the conference. I was blown away when I read this. And then this. Wow! If you read the comments, Michael took a lot of flack for endorsing Silverlight. I know he’s genuine though. I spent 30 min. in an anaylst meeting with Scott Guthrie and I got 10 min. of Scott’s vision and his committment is obvious. If Michael spent 10 hours with those guys like he mentions, then he I don’t see how he could have been anything other than blown away.
There are many more favorite moments I’m sure. It would probably be easier to start enumerating the moments where I wasn’t having a blast. Great job Microsoft and and especially big congrats to the Silverlight team!
Darren David
05 may 2007
I’m about a week out from publishing a C# library with the Penner easing equations that fully uses the WPF animation system, and adds several other niceties as well. I’ll post on my blog when they’re ready for prime time…
Neil
08 may 2007
Hi Robby, sorry if I’m invading your blog. I caught the video of the WPF comic reader and it looks fantastic. Since you seemed so jazzed about “comic theory,” I just wanted to contact you and let you know I’ve been doing a lot of research on this for the past several years, and you can see a bunch of my work at my website. I have a lot of thoughts on comics and software, so if you’re interested in chatting, drop me a line.
Again, the WPF looks great, congrats!
notstatic.com
31 may 2007
[...] This is a good memory! Lee was cluing me in on some of the more sophisticated things people are doing with Flash animations. Funny, because I blogged about this very conversation as a MIX highlight. Unbeknownst to me, Darren David must have been thinking about the same thing because not long after my conversation with Lee, the PennerDoubleAnimation class showed up on his blog. Very cool stuff! [...]